Immediate Cardiopulmonary Stabilization Adv Tech

Abstract

This Project covers development, pre-clinical and early-clinical demonstration, and transition of technologies for immediate pre-hospital hemorrhage detection and control and airway management. These technologies facilitate autonomous intubation and airway management in combat casualties with obstructed airways. This Project also demonstrates advanced technologies for use in forward areas to detect and control non-compressible internal bleeding, and demonstration of pain-relieving drugs that are safe for use during bleeding. Promising efforts identified through Applied Research conducted under Program Element (PE) 0602787A (Medical Technology) / Project MM4 (Cbt Casualty Care Applied Rsch Technology) are further matured under this Project. Promising results identified under this Project are further matured under PE 0603807A (Medical Systems Advanced Development) / Project 836 (Field Medical Systems Advanced Development). The cited research is consistent with the Under Secretary of Defense (Research and Engineering) science and technology focus areas and the Army Modernization Strategy. Research in this Project is performed by the United States Army Medical Research and Development Command (USAMRDC), Fort Detrick, MD.
